CourseDetails
โข Fundamentals of Battery Nanotechnology: An introductory unit covering the basics of battery nanotechnology, including nanoscale electrodes, electrolytes, and energy storage mechanisms.
โข Advanced Battery Materials: This unit explores the latest advances in battery materials, including nanostructured electrodes, high-capacity anodes, and solid-state electrolytes.
โข Battery Design and Fabrication Techniques: Students learn about the various design and fabrication techniques used in battery nanotechnology, including 3D printing, lithography, and self-assembly.
โข Battery Management Systems: An in-depth look at battery management systems, including charge and discharge algorithms, thermal management, and fault diagnosis.
โข Nanotechnology for Electric Vehicles: This unit covers the application of battery nanotechnology in electric vehicles, including range anxiety, fast-charging, and safety concerns.
โข Emerging Trends in Battery Nanotechnology: Students explore the latest trends and research directions in battery nanotechnology, including flexible batteries, solid-state batteries, and aqueous batteries.
โข Battery Testing and Characterization: This unit covers the various techniques used to test and characterize batteries, including cyclic voltammetry, electrochemical impedance spectroscopy, and galvanostatic charging/discharging.
โข Sustainability and Environmental Impact of Batteries: An examination of the sustainability and environmental impact of batteries, including the use of recycling and renewable energy sources.
